Output e7d33c6c952082104934755c6edbc41e5a2b8e91b0373f81f15cc688ea40634f:70

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 54661b51d471bcf2e8195eea575bffbb3059d9de
address
bc1q23npk5w5wx7096qetm49wkllhvc9nkw7y6q0xm
transaction
e7d33c6c952082104934755c6edbc41e5a2b8e91b0373f81f15cc688ea40634f
spent
true